Treatment Options Offered:

  1. Laser Lithotripsy (URS/RIRS):
    A high-precision, minimally invasive procedure where a laser is used to break kidney stones into tiny fragments, allowing them to pass naturally or be removed with minimal trauma.

  2. PCNL (Percutaneous Nephrolithotomy):
    This is the gold-standard treatment for large or complex kidney stones. A small incision is made in the back to access the kidney and remove the stones directly. It ensures complete stone clearance with high success rates.

  3. ESWL (Extracorporeal Shock Wave Lithotripsy):
    A non-invasive option that uses focused shock waves to break smaller stones into fragments, enabling them to pass through urine over time. It’s ideal for select cases and requires no incisions.

Common Symptoms of Kidney Stones Include:

  • Severe lower back or side pain

  • Blood in urine (hematuria)

  • Frequent or painful urination

  • Nausea and vomiting
